I have two of these and switch between them every week. Have had them for 5+ years. They work perfectly. The generic replacement brushes on Amazon are every bit as good as the overpriced Braun OEM ones for a fraction of the price.

imho, the counter rotating brush heads work much better than Sonicare's vibrating brush heads. More bristle tip movement = more cleaning. And especially more likely to get in and clean between the teeth & gums...which seems to help prevent, reduce and/or eliminate the "deep pockets" problem.
